Triumph Tiger description

 IMMACULATE, RESTORED TIGER DAYTONA. BOYER IGNITION AND BORED OUT TO 530CC. SINGLE CARB CONVERSION. THIS BIKE DOESN'T LEAK AND KICK STARTS VERY EASILY. THIS BIKE IS EXTREMELY RELIABLE, I'D RIDE IT ANYWHERE WITHOUT HESITATION. IT WILL START AND WILL NOT BREAK DOWN. SHE RUNS AND LOOKS LIKE A BRAND NEW BIKE. THIS BIKE IS LIGHT AND VERY NIMBLE, IT'S A GOOD CHOICE FOR A 1ST TIME BUYER, A PERSON TIRED OF THE UNRELIABILITY OF MOST BRITISH BIKES BUT WANTS A TRUE VINTAGE MOTORCYCLE, OR SOMEONE TIRED OF THE WEIGHT AND AWKWARDNESS OF SOME OF THE OLDER BIKES. THE SMITHS SPEEDO QUIT SHORTLY AFTER RESTORATION AND SAW NO POINT IN FIXING IT. IF I HAD TO GUESS IT'S GOT ABOUT 1500 MILES ON IT, SO WELL BROKEN IN. BID WITH CONFIDENCE YOU WILL NOT BE DISAPPOINTED. 2015 Triumph Daytona 250 Spied

Fri, 29 Nov 2013

Spy photographers have captured images of Triumph‘s upcoming 250cc sportbike. The new sportbike (we’re calling it the Daytona 250 until Triumph tells us otherwise) is one of two new 250cc single-cylinder models Triumph is designed primarily for India, where Triumph officially started operations this week. There is a very good chance however the Daytona 250 and its naked roadster sibling will be exported to other markets including here in the U.S.

Latus Motors Reveals Gary Nixon Tribute Livery for Triumph Daytona 675R AMA Race Bike

Tue, 13 Mar 2012

Latus Motors is honoring the late Gary Nixon with a special livery for its Triumph 675R entry in the 2012 Daytona 200. Nixon passed away last year after a heart attack but his memory will live on at Daytona. Defending Daytona 200 winner Jason DiSalvo will try to repeat on the Triumph Daytona 675R wearing leathers inspired by Nixon’s gear as well as the racing legend’s #9.
